I was catching up on the 2051 season tonight, and was shocked to see the All-Star game result: an utter curbstomp of the Johnson All-Stars via the mighty boot of the Frick All-Stars. An 11-0 game shutout recorded by Frick, with the Frick contingent outhitting their opponents 16-3! Pretty impressive to limit an All-Star team to 3 hits when you are cycling pitchers in and out constantly, right?!

Since the BBA apparently has no inter-league play, there's no other easy barometer to gauge which league is better, and this begs the question ...

There's a clear divide in pitching/hitting talent. Johnson League has the best hitters and the worst pitchers. The top NINE teams in runs scored this season are from the Johnson League. Pitching is our weakest asset, and it was on display at the ASG. And I guess the bats fell asleep that day. It's a long flight up to Twin Cities.
